As a Billing Clerk, you will audit and post incoming deals into the accounting system while verifying details and supporting documentation.

- A detail-oriented individual able to complete and verify documentation in an accurate and efficient manner.
- Friendliness, enthusiasm, reliability, with a positive "team-player" attitude.
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and organizational skills.
- Strong work ethic with the ability to work in a fast-paced, results-driven environment.
- Strong mathematical, analytical, and computer skills relevant to a billing clerk position, with at least one year of recent applicable experience.
- Experience in automotive accounting roles, including working with dealership management systems (DMS), processing repair orders, billing, and understanding automotive accounting workflows.
- Commitment:
Ensure that our Penske Automotive Group dealerships run effectively and efficiently by accurately performing accounting duties as assigned. - Excellence:
Compile and sort documents substantiating business transactions, prepare vouchers, invoices, checks, account statements, reports, and other records quickly and accurately. - Accountability:
Understand and comply with all regulations that affect the accounting department, and perform tasks accurately, fairly, and in accordance with local, state, and federal statutes, as well as company policies.
